Output 2f31a562c6e1b360459b62f5c736d3cd99099f957c4b93647ec691cf68c7e71c:0

value
1062430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50df74128b8e91ea53134bf819f2f0147c348b94 OP_EQUAL
address
394dfhrQifaUC3tKJXKhBrBdCLAZ6UYDzs
transaction
2f31a562c6e1b360459b62f5c736d3cd99099f957c4b93647ec691cf68c7e71c
spent
true